Description

The Assistant Planner, Sales Planning – Haircare supports the Senior Manager and owns end-to-end planning for Tier 2 wholesale accounts, including forecasting, inventory planning, execution, and broader planning initiatives.

This role maintains Stock & Sales Plans, manages order and PO workflows, provides insights, and partners cross-functionally to support in-stock levels and operational excellence.

 

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Wholesale Account Planning (Tier 2 Ownership)
•    Own sales and inventory planning for Tier 2 wholesale accounts, including forecasting, replenishment, and in-season management
•    Build and maintain Stock & Sales Plans, incorporating distribution changes, promotions, and launches
•    Monitor account performance, identify risks and opportunities, and adjust forecasts
•    Partner with Sales and Account Management on sales expectations and shipment plans

 

Stock & Sales Plan Support (Tier 1 Support)
•    Support the Senior Manager in maintaining Stock & Sales Plans for Tier 1 accounts
•    Assist in seasonal planning materials, including recaps, analysis, and programming calendars
•    Maintain shared planning tools, trackers, and calendars for alignment and accuracy

 

Forecasting, Replenishment & Inventory Management
•    Manage replenishment and inventory flow for Tier 2 accounts, including forecast exceptions and WOS metrics
•    Analyze data to identify OOS risks, imbalances, and reorder opportunities
•    Track SKU lifecycle changes and ensure accurate system updates
•    Submit and manage DIF and RTV requests
•    Support inventory clean-up and resolve discrepancies

 

Shipment, Order & PO Management
•    Own PO tracking for assigned accounts, ensuring forecast and inventory alignment
•    Monitor order status, receipts, cancellations, and changes; flag risks and follow up with partners
•    Maintain accurate order logs and shipment trackers
•    Support SKU- and door-level analysis for reorder, event, and opening order recommendations

 

Launch Management
•    Own planning support for launches across Tier 2 accounts, including setup, forecasting, and tracking
•    Prepare launch documentation, including distribution lists, door-level plans, and setup files
•    Track and analyze launch performance, providing insights and recommendations

 

Assortment & Administrative Support
•    Maintain assortment tools, SKU trackers, and pricing updates
•    Support system and retailer template updates for SKU changes, discontinuations, and RTVs
•    Prepare materials for retailer meetings and internal reviews

 

Reporting & Analytics
•    Maintain reporting on sales, inventory, WOS, service levels, returns, and PO tracking
•    Build standardized reports and dashboards for the Senior Manager and planning team
•    Provide insights on trends, risks, and opportunities to support decision-making

 

Cross-Functional & Retailer Support
•    Partner with Sales, Demand Planning, Supply Chain, and Customer Service on forecasts, inventory, and execution
•    Support communication to retailers and field teams on OOS updates, in-stock timing, and assortment changes
•    Assist in developing tools and materials for internal and external stakeholders
